DILI, 12 february 2026 (TATOLI) – The President of the Republic, Jose Ramos-Horta sworn in Regina de Jesus de Sousa as the new Deputy Minister of Finance of the IX Constitutional Government.
The ceremony took place at the Nicolau Lobato Presidential Palace.
The appointment was formalized under the Decree of the President of the Republic No. 17/2026.
Regina de Jesus de Sousa succeeds the former Deputy Minister of Finance, Felícia Claudinanda Cruz Carvalho.
Regina de Jesus de Sousa is a financial expert with more than 20 years of experience in the Ministry of Finance.
She brings high-level technical expertise in Public Finance Management (PFM) to her new position.
As the former Director General of the Treasury, she was instrumental in ensuring the integrity, efficiency, and transparency of the state’s financial systems.
Sousa’s leadership covers strategic areas including national accounting, treasury operations, budget execution, and payroll management, directly supporting government policy and PFM reforms.
Known for her analytical skills and compliance expertise, Sousa has a strong track record of building teams, fostering cross-agency cooperation, and advising state bodies on budgetary matters.
Her expertise has been enhanced through advanced international training with the IMF and ADB, focusing on treasury modernization, debt sustainability, and fiscal policy.
President Ramos-Horta said “I have full confidence that Mrs. Regina de Jesus de Sousa will bring her exceptional expertise, unwavering integrity, and profound commitment to public service to this vital role. Her leadership will be crucial in advancing our nation’s economic stability, ensuring fiscal discipline, and reinforcing the foundations of good governance for the benefit of all Timorese people.”
The ceremony marked the formal transfer of duties and the commencement of the new Deputy Minister’s term of office.
